7.2 . TIG/TIG AC WELDING
Connect the TIG torch to the negative socket, •P1.
Connect the earth clamp to the positive socket, •P2.
Connect the gas pipe for the torch to the gas connector •A2.
Connect the torch connector to connector •J2.
Connect the gas pipe from the gas bottle to the gas connector A1.
